Understanding the Basics

Connectors are devices designed to join electrical circuits, enabling communication between different components. The performance and durability of these connectors largely depend on the hardware components utilized during their manufacturing. To maintain high standards and efficiency, connectors manufacturers must be familiar with several critical elements, including housing, contacts, insulators, and locking mechanisms. Each of these components plays a unique role in ensuring that connectors function properly and meet the demands of various applications.

Housing: The Protective Shield

The housing of a connector is its outer shell, constructed from materials such as plastic, metal, or composites. It serves as the first line of defense against environmental factors, such as dust, moisture, and temperature fluctuations. For connectors manufacturers, choosing the right housing material is crucial for ensuring longevity and performance. Manufacturers often look for materials that provide excellent mechanical strength and durability while also being lightweight and cost-effective. The right housing not only protects internal components but also impacts the overall aesthetics and reliability of the connector.

Contacts: The Heart of Connection

Contacts are the conductive elements within a connector that facilitate the electrical connection. The design and material of contacts significantly influence their performance, including conductivity and resistance to wear. Connectors manufacturers often opt for materials such as copper or nickel alloys, which provide excellent electrical and thermal conductivity while resisting corrosion. Additionally, the geometry of contacts, such as their shape and spacing, is crucial for ensuring a secure connection. Understanding the intricacies of contact design can greatly enhance a manufacturer’s ability to produce effective and reliable connectors.

Insulators: Ensuring Safety and Efficiency

Insulators are another critical hardware component that connectors manufacturers must prioritize. These materials prevent electrical leakage and cross-talk between adjacent contacts, ensuring safe and efficient operation. Common insulating materials include thermoplastics and ceramics, chosen for their dielectric properties. The selection of insulators should align with the specific application requirements, including temperature ratings and chemical resistance. By focusing on high-quality insulators, connectors manufacturers can improve their products' safety and reliability, ultimately leading to better customer satisfaction.

Locking Mechanisms: Securing Connections

A reliable connector does not only provide a good electrical connection; it also ensures that this connection remains intact under various conditions. Locking mechanisms secure the connection between the male and female components, preventing accidental disconnection. Connectors manufacturers have various options when it comes to locking mechanisms, such as latches, screws, or bayonet mounts. The choice of locking mechanism depends on the application’s demands and the environment in which the connector will function. By offering connectors with robust locking mechanisms, manufacturers can significantly reduce the risk of disconnections in critical applications.
